#3f0060 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3f0060 is composed of 24.7% red, 0%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.4% cyan, 100% magenta, 0% yellow and 62.4% black. It has a hue angle of 279.4 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 18.8%. #3f0060 color hex could be obtained by blending #7e00c0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#3f0060 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3f0060 has RGB values of R:63, G:0,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:1, Y:0,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 4128864.
